How do you replace a battery
If you've tried reprogramming your key fob, and then replaced its battery but still aren't having any luck, you may need a new receiver module to your car key Fob Replacement. This is a lengthy procedure that requires specialized equipment that only a locksmith for automotive or dealer will have access to.
The most common cause of a malfunctioning key fob is the simple battery inside that has been depleted of power. Be sure to buy the replacement battery identical in voltage and size as the previous one. Otherwise, you may damage the circuitry that forms part of the key fob.
To replace the battery, look for small slots on the side of the key fob opposite to the one that houses the mechanical key. Use a small screwdriver to insert it into the slot and gently pry off the plastic casing. Do not apply too much pressure, since the battery compartment is extremely thin and will break if you press it too hard.
After you've installed the new battery place the battery's back on your fob and carefully slide the cover back onto. If you're having difficulty getting the rear of the fob to snap into place Don't use too much force. Once the cover is installed and you're ready to test your Kia Sportsage's key fob by pressing on its lock or unlock button. If the door cylinders and trunk unlock, you're set!
How do I reprogram the key?
The transponder chip found in Kia key fobs must be activated to start your vehicle. This is done by connecting an electronic programming machine to the computer in the car to let it know you have an "authorized" key inside the key fob. Certain dealers and locksmiths have these devices in their inventory.
A common cause for remote keys not locking or unlocking the vehicle is a dead battery on the key fob. If you notice that the range is decreasing slowly until it ceases to function completely, the battery in the keyfob is getting old and needs to be replaced.
Another common issue is interference from nearby objects the car or from transmitters operating on the same frequency band as the key fob. This could interfere with the signal and prevent the car from starting if you press the start button on the key fob.

How do I get a replacement key made
You'll need to speak with an authorized locksmith or dealer for a new Kia key. They can make keys to older models. However, modern Kias come with a smart fob or remote with a chip embedded and requires a professional coder.
The dealer will need the key code which is printed on a tag that is attached to your key set. This information will also be required by the locksmith, so be sure to write it down in a safe place.
Once they have the key code, they will need to program it into your car. To do this, they'll require the proper equipment. It is best to find a local locksmith who specializes in Kias. They'll have the best knowledge of this kind of vehicle and be able to tell you how to fix a kia key fob to operate it properly.
Test the key after they're done. Verify that the key can open your trunk and doors and also starts the engine. Make sure the emergency key is working as you might require it in the event that you get locked out. How do I get an access code
If you own a newer Kia with a built-in keyless entry system, you will need to obtain a key code from a dealer or locksmith to create an entirely new key. Dealers can use a specific machine to create a new key for the vehicle. They will also have a computer that is able to program the transponder chip within the key. Locksmiths do not have a computer for this, but they are able to cut the mechanical key and then insert the key into the vehicle's lock.
